Just about the most widely administered IQ assessments for children could be the WISC-V Check (Wechsler Intelligence Scale for youngsters). This exam yields 5 "Issue Scores," such as Verbal Comprehension, Visible-Spatial Capacity, Fluid Reasoning Ability Perceptual Capacity and Working Memory - reflecting distinctive Proportions of intelligence and providing important Perception into cognitive capabilities and Studying models of your child.

Lots of assessments designed for kids involve inquiries that require them to reply within a particular time period, with outcomes then in comparison with ordinary IQ scores for that age group and a regular rating generated. This score is commonly known as their Whole Scale IQ score.

These assessments are structured to progressively boost in problems as young children answer appropriately, encouraging stop take a look at takers from guessing or using methods when also supplying a more correct reflection of a Kid's genuine IQ.

IQ tests offer only snapshots of your child's performance at 1 moment in time. Young children could be fatigued, unwell or nervous on testing working day and this will likely adversely effect their results. Furthermore, a seasoned psychologist really should take into consideration different aspects of a Kid's background for instance household ties, cultural influences, educational activities and developmental history so that you can paint an accurate portrait of your son or daughter past simply just test scores by yourself.

Kids may well experience issue on exams as a consequence of some subtests beginning off additional easily than Other folks. For instance, precocious young learners with sturdy vocabulary competencies might do properly on WISC-V (and older variations), but wrestle on Visible Spatial and Fluid Reasoning subtests - and in the end this decreased subtest score will common out together with her other scores and effects her final outcome (recognised by various tests as total scale rating, GIA rating or other conditions).

Even when your child is All round gifted, This will continue to have adverse consequences. Fortunately, several gifted young children have a number of regions of power to counterbalance any adverse impacts. When this happens, a psychologist may possibly advocate an accomplishment examination to achieve a lot more insight into how your child learns and what their accurate cognitive capabilities are.

One of the best alternate options to IQ tests for children would be the Wechsler Preschool and first Scale of Intelligence - Fifth Version (WPPSI-IV). This exam is customized for youngsters from two many years and six months nearly 7 a long time and seven months, administered by a psychologist, having between 65-80 minutes determined by how many subtests are taken; normally expected if implementing to gifted applications or private educational institutions.
